Why is predicting the weather difficult?

Since we can’t collect data from the future, models have to use estimates and assumptions to predict future weather. The atmosphere is changing all the time, so those estimates are less reliable the further you get into the future.

Why is it difficult to predict weather more than a week?

The reason it’s so hard to predict the weather very far in advance is because weather is incredibly complex and dynamic. Factors like today’s temperature, humidity, prevailing winds, and local geography all have an influence on tomorrow’s weather.

How accurate is weather prediction?

Longer-range forecasts are less accurate. Data from the National Oceanic and Atmospheric Administration suggests a seven-day forecast can accurately predict the weather about 80 percent of the time, and a five-day forecast can accurately predict the weather approximately 90 percent of the time.

How can the tools be used to predict future weather?

They collect and share data to help improve forecasts. Some of the tools they use include barometers that measure air pressure, anemometers that measure wind speed, Doppler radar stations to monitor the movement of weather fronts, and psychrometers to measure relative humidity.

Why it is easy to predict its climate?

Weather is a complex phenomenon which can vary over a short period of time and thus is difficult to predict. It is easier to predict climate as it is the average weather pattern taken over a long time.

What are differences between weather and climate?

Weather refers to short term atmospheric conditions while climate is the weather of a specific region averaged over a long period of time.

What tools can predict weather?

Tools meteorologists use include thermometers (temperature), barometers (pressure), rain gauges (rainfall), wind vanes (wind speed), weather balloons, and weather satellites.

Where are the computers used to predict the weather?

In the United States, these computers are housed at the National Centers for Environmental Prediction (NCEP), located in Camp Springs, Md. There, weather observations stream into a supercomputer’s brain, which uses complex mathematical models to predict how, based on the incoming data, weather conditions might change over time.

How are weather models used to predict weather?

Weather models use mathematical equations to analyze and predict atmospheric processes and changes. Weather models use a simplified picture or “grid” of the land surface. This is similar to a road map or a topographic map. For example, sometimes the resolution of weather models use a grid size of 12 km.
